Accessing Energy Consumption Data

To begin exploring your Volvo Recharge’s energy data, start with the central infotainment touchscreen, which serves as the command center for vehicle settings and information. Depending on the model and software version, the energy-related information is typically accessible via a dedicated “Energy” or “Efficiency” tab within the main menu. This section consolidates real-time and historical metrics related to battery status, energy flow, and consumption patterns.

Once inside the energy interface, you can view various interactive gauges and graphs that illustrate how your vehicle is utilizing power at any given moment. This includes the current battery charge level, estimated remaining driving range, and an overview of how energy is being distributed between the electric motor, internal combustion engine (in plug-in hybrids), and regenerative braking system. The interface updates dynamically, allowing you to monitor shifts in real-time as you accelerate, decelerate, or switch between driving modes.

Additionally, some Volvo Recharge models offer integration with companion smartphone apps, enabling you to remotely access energy consumption statistics, precondition your vehicle, and even plan charging sessions. These digital extensions complement the in-car tools by providing greater flexibility in managing your vehicle’s energy usage outside of the driving environment.

Key Features to Monitor for Optimal Energy Use

  • Energy Flow Visualization: This intuitive graphic display reveals how energy moves between the battery, electric motors, and engine (if applicable) in real time. For plug-in hybrids, it clearly shows when the vehicle is running purely on electric power, gasoline, or a combination of both. Additionally, it highlights when regenerative braking is active, converting kinetic energy back into stored electrical energy to improve overall efficiency.
  • Consumption History and Trends: Volvo’s system logs energy consumption data over various timeframes—such as by trip, day, week, or month—allowing you to identify usage trends and patterns. This historical perspective can help you detect inefficient driving habits, plan charging schedules, and compare energy use across different routes or driving conditions.
  • Driving Efficiency Feedback and Tips: Many Recharge models provide personalized advice based on your driving style and energy consumption data. For example, the system might suggest smoother acceleration, reduced high-speed driving, or increased use of regenerative braking. These recommendations are designed to help you extend your battery range and reduce fuel consumption without sacrificing driving pleasure.
  • Range Prediction and Battery Health: Beyond immediate consumption data, the tools also offer range estimates based on current battery charge and recent driving behavior, factoring in variables like terrain, temperature, and speed. Some models provide battery health status indicators, alerting you to any factors that might impact long-term battery performance or charging efficiency.
  • Route Planning with Energy Optimization: Integrated navigation systems can factor in energy consumption to suggest routes that optimize battery usage. These routes may avoid heavy traffic, steep inclines, or areas lacking charging infrastructure, helping you maintain a consistent charge and reduce range anxiety.

Understanding Regenerative Braking Data

Regenerative braking is a cornerstone feature of Volvo Recharge models, capturing energy during deceleration and converting it back into electrical power stored in the battery. The energy flow visualization highlights when regenerative braking is active, and the system quantifies the amount of energy recovered. Monitoring this data encourages efficient driving techniques such as gentle braking and coasting, which maximize energy recapture and extend driving range.

Exploring Trip-Based Analytics

Your Volvo Recharge’s analytical tools provide detailed breakdowns for individual trips, including total energy consumed, average consumption per mile or kilometer, and the proportion of electric versus combustion engine use (in PHEVs). Reviewing these trip reports helps you understand how different types of journeys—city commuting versus highway driving, for example—impact your energy consumption, allowing you to tailor your driving habits accordingly.

Tips for Effective Energy Monitoring and Management

  1. Monitor Energy Consumption Regularly: Make it a habit to check your energy consumption statistics frequently, both during and after trips. This ongoing awareness helps you understand how variables such as weather, traffic, and driving style influence efficiency, enabling you to adjust your behavior proactively.
  2. Master Regenerative Braking: Use regenerative braking strategically by anticipating stops and easing off the accelerator early. This technique maximizes energy recovery and reduces brake wear. Experiment with different driving modes—such as “B” mode in some models—which enhance regenerative braking strength for more aggressive energy recapture.
  3. Optimize Route Planning: Utilize the built-in navigation system’s energy-optimized routing features to avoid congested areas and steep hills, which can drain battery power quickly. Planning your trips around available charging stations also ensures you maintain sufficient charge for longer journeys.
  4. Adjust Climate Control Settings: Climate control systems can be significant energy consumers. Use preconditioning features to heat or cool your vehicle while it is still plugged in, reducing reliance on battery power during driving. Additionally, moderate temperature settings and seat heaters can be more efficient alternatives to full cabin heating or cooling.
  5. Leverage Driving Modes: Volvo Recharge vehicles often feature multiple drive modes—such as Pure, Hybrid, and Power—that influence energy consumption patterns. Experiment with these modes to find the best balance between performance and efficiency for your typical driving scenarios.
  6. Maintain Proper Tire Pressure: Underinflated tires increase rolling resistance and energy consumption. Regularly check and maintain tire pressure at recommended levels to ensure optimal efficiency and safety.
  7. Keep Software Updated: Volvo frequently releases software updates that enhance energy management algorithms and infotainment features. Ensure your vehicle’s systems are up to date to benefit from the latest improvements in efficiency and usability.

Advanced Energy Analysis: Beyond the Basics

For drivers seeking deeper insights, Volvo Recharge models provide advanced data visualization and export options. Some infotainment systems allow you to export trip energy data via USB or sync with Volvo’s cloud services, enabling detailed analysis on your computer or smartphone. This capability is particularly useful for fleet drivers or those who want to track energy use over extended periods and multiple vehicles.

Moreover, integration with third-party apps and platforms—such as smart home energy management systems or electric vehicle charging networks—can help you optimize not only driving efficiency but also charging costs and environmental impact. For instance, scheduling charging sessions during off-peak electricity hours reduces energy expenses and grid strain.

Using Volvo On Call and Connected Services

Volvo On Call, the manufacturer’s connected car service, enriches your energy management experience by providing remote access to vehicle status, charging progress, and climate control. Through the Volvo On Call smartphone app, you can remotely start or stop charging, monitor battery levels in real time, and receive notifications about charging completion or alerts. This remote functionality helps you better plan trips, avoid unexpected energy shortages, and maintain optimal battery health.

Understanding Energy Impact of Accessory Use

Accessories such as headlights, infotainment systems, and heated seats, while essential for comfort and safety, can incrementally increase energy consumption. By monitoring how these systems affect battery use through your Volvo’s energy tools, you can make informed decisions—for example, dimming interior lights or using seat heaters instead of full cabin heating—to further optimize efficiency.
